Rocky Mountain
National Park Information

Location‎: ‎Larimer‎ / ‎Grand‎ / Boulder counties,

Area‎: ‎265,461 acres (1,074.28 km2)

Nearest city‎: ‎Estes Park, CO‎ and ‎Grand Lake‎, CO

Established‎: ‎January 26, 1915

4-5 million recreational visitors per year

UNESCO designated the park as a World Biosphere Reserves in 1976

The Rocky Mountain National Park Act was signed by President Woodrow Wilson

The park has a total of five visitor centers

Trail Ridge Road is the highest paved through-road in the country, with a peak elevation of 12,183 feet (3,713 m)
